Player Bio

Anrich Nortje has established himself as a formidable fast bowler, but his career has been plagued by injuries that have forced him to miss several key tournaments for South Africa. Despite these setbacks, he has continued to be a vital part of the Proteas' pace attack whenever fit.

In April 2021, Nortje was named in Eastern Province’s squad ahead of the 2021–22 domestic cricket season in South Africa, reinforcing his presence in the domestic circuit. Later that year, in September 2021, he was included in South Africa’s squad for the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up, highlighting his importance in the national setup.

His growing reputation as a fast bowler saw him attract attention from leagues around the world. In March 2023, he was drafted into the Washington Freedom squad for the inaugural season of Major League Cricket (MLC) in the United States. However, in the same year, he suffered a major setback when he was named in South Africa’s squad for the 2023 Cricket World Cup but had to withdraw due to injury, a recurring issue that has troubled his career.

Nortje continued to be a key player for South Africa when fit, and in May 2024, he was once again included in the national squad for the 2024 ICC Men’s T20 World Cup. His pace and ability to trouble batsmen made him a crucial asset for the Proteas.

In franchise cricket, Nortje’s services remained in high demand. In November 2024, he was picked up by the Kolkata Knight Riders for INR 6.50 crores in the IPL 2025 auction, marking his return to the franchise. However, his battle with injuries continued to be a concern. In 2025, just before the ICC Champions Trophy, he was ruled out due to a back injury, forcing South Africa to bring in Corbin Bosch as his replacement.

Despite his struggles with injuries, Nortje remains one of the most feared fast bowlers in world cricket. His raw pace and aggressive bowling make him a prized asset for any team, and if he can overcome his injury concerns, he is likely to continue making significant contributions to both South African cricket and various T20 leagues around the world.

(As of May 2025)
